Output 093ba2576b23865500a5d6d1b39f99eac030e93e13aa4a4aae1d3d8460b55931:0

value
51842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2a8265e00975d867d5e9cee14768abe835e2f7 OP_EQUAL
address
34FwmWyUTWWe2PT6vepW1KuFeDJf5jrNz5
transaction
093ba2576b23865500a5d6d1b39f99eac030e93e13aa4a4aae1d3d8460b55931
confirmations
125167
spent
true